INCI glossary name
POLYAMINOPROPYL BIGUANIDE
Chemical name
Polyhexamethylene biguanide hydrochloride
Chemical / IUPAC name
Polyhexamethylene biguanide hydrochloride
Maximum concentration
0.1%
Other restrictions
Not to be used in applications that may lead to exposure of the end-user's lungs by inhalation
